DH+ via 1784-KTX Card on Windows XP

5 posts in this topic

Hi there, I have a SCADA system communicating with a number of Allen-Bradley PLC-5's over DH+ networks, via 1784-KTX cards. The system currently runs under Windows 2000 Pro. I will shortly be needing to upgrade the OS to Windows XP. Does anyone know whether the 1784-KTX card (drivers, RSLinx, etc.) is compatible with XP Pro? Glenikins

I am presently using 1784-PKTX & 1784-PKTXD on Windows XP Pro SP1 machines with no issues. We also use Control Logix chassis with 1756-DHRIO & 1756-ENBT to get DH+ access from the network.

1784-KTX is an ISA bus card interface to DH+. 1784-PKTX is a PCI bus card interface to DH+. If you are only upgrading the operating system to Windows XP and are not also changing the hardware, then you should have Windows support for your ISA bus and RSLinx will run the drivers for the 1784-KTX card. The PCI version of the card is recommended for Windows 2000 and XP, but the ISA card *should* work. If you are also upgrading the PC hardware, all bets are off. Even the 1784-PKTX cards have some trouble with modern dual-core processors and super-fast bus speeds. You might have to use a USB/DH+ device like the 1784-U2DHP with a new computer.
